Home Price Trends — Endicott, WA
As of Nov '25, the median home price in Endicott, WA is $229,000, with a year-over-year change of -8.3%. This indicates that home prices in Endicott, WA are decreasing. According to Zillow, the 1-year price projection is 1.5%, suggesting an increase housing market in the next year.

Demographics — Endicott, WA
As of the latest ACS Survey released in 2023, Endicott, WA has a population of 636, which has increased by 5.5% over the past 5 years. Endicott, WA is a popular place for families, as children make up 32.7% of the population. The area has a poorly educated workforce, with 21.0% of adult residents holding a bachelor’s degree or higher. There are few residents working remotely, with 6.0% reporting working from home.
